Chitranga Population - Paschim Medinipur, West Bengal

Chitranga is a medium size village located in Binpur - I Block of Paschim Medinipur district, West Bengal with total 331 families residing. The Chitranga village has population of 1524 of which 770 are males while 754 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chitranga village population of children with age 0-6 is 216 which makes up 14.17 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chitranga village is 979 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Chitranga as per census is 862, lower than West Bengal average of 956.

Chitranga village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Chitranga village was 74.54 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Chitranga Male literacy stands at 84.86 % while female literacy rate was 64.22 %.

Caste Factor

Chitranga village of Paschim Medinipur has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 27.17 % of total population in Chitranga village. The village Chitranga curr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Chitranga village out of total population, 546 were engaged in work activities. 73.26 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 26.74 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 546 workers engaged in Main Work, 203 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 128 were Agricultural labourer.
